## Sensor drift: what to do at 3am

If the GrowLoop controller starts reporting humidity swings that don't match the backup probes in the Fernwick greenhouse, it's almost always sensor drift, not an actual climate event. Don't panic and don't touch the vents manually. First, restart the calibration daemon and give it ten minutes to re-baseline. If readings still disagree by more than 5%, flip the controller into safe mode. The safe-mode thresholds it will use are these.

config for yahap-bajof:
[istix]
host = istix.qorvelsys.internal
user = istix_svc
database = istix_prod

## Deployment

Shelfhook imports catalogue records in batches. Plugin authors: your hooks run inside the import worker, not the web tier. Deploy order matters — migrate the schema, restart workers, then re-enable the ingest queue. Failed batches retry three times, then land in the dead-letter table; your plugin must be idempotent. Do not write to the catalogue tables directly; use the staging API. Worker concurrency, batch size, and retry backoff for the import service are set as follows.

deployment values, yadug-bawif:
[framir]
team = pelox
access_code = ac_a38ab2
owner = tamion.julael
host = framir.tolvaqlabs.test
port = 11211
peer = tammir.zemvargrid.local
salt = 2215ef03
pin = 1541

TURN-208: Gatevale turnstile counters at the Merrow Field pilot double-count when a rotation reverses mid-cycle. Attendance totals drift roughly 2% high per event. The debounce window fix is implemented, reviewed by Ilsa, and soak-tested across two simulated match days without drift. Ready for your cut; the candidate build is identified below.

trace token, tagag-tafog: htk6_5ed18c

Handover: Deep-link routing for the Fernwick app (from Dario to Ilse)

Support team: all inbound deep links now route through the Lanternpath resolver before hitting native screens. If a user reports links opening the home tab instead of the target order, check the resolver cache first — it expires every six hours. Clearing it requires the recovery console, which Ilse now owns. To unlock the console after a failed session, the system prompts for a recovery passphrase, which is recorded directly below.

unlock words, bahop-fawef: novmir-druwyn-soriel-rusdor-kasion